Angular--官方文档之 Angular CLI

2023-11-09

学习Angular官方文档的时候,参考https://angular.cn/guide/quickstart   这个快速开发的文档。

对于我这个AngularJs小白在看了Angular菜鸟教程后,只能说可以简单的运用一下。

看到一些专业术语,我也是一脸懵逼的。

1.Angular CLI是什么?

Angular CLI避免了自己创建项目配置文件的一系列繁琐的操作,简单的来说就是项目的 脚手架

问题又来了,脚手架是个什么鬼?

脚手架可以避免项目的一些重复的操作。感觉自己说了一句废话。(当初年少不懂事,面试的时候面试官问我脚手架是什么?)

2.Angular CLI的特性

1 Angular CLI 可以快速搭建框架,创建module,service,class,directive等;

2 具有webpack的功能,代码分割(code splitting),按需加载;

3 代码打包压缩;

4 模块测试,端到端测试;

5 热部署,有改动立即重新编译,不用刷新浏览器;而且速度很快

6 有开发环境,测试环境,生产环境的配置,不用自己操心; 

7 sass,less的预编译Angular CLI都会自动识别后缀来编译;

8 typescript的配置,Angular CLI在创建应用时都可以自己配置;

9 在创建好的工程也可以做一些个性化的配置,webpack的具体配置还不支持,未来可能会增加;

10 Angular CLI创建的工程结构是最佳实践,生产可用;


本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)

Angular--官方文档之 Angular CLI 的相关文章

  • AngularJS 忽略一些标头

    我正在玩一点 Angular 遇到了一个小问题 我正在尝试为http响应设置一个自定义标头 然后在角度方面读取它的值 标头已设置 我确信这一点 因为 chrome 的调试工具确认了 这意味着服务器端没问题 到目前为止 一切都很好 当我尝试通
  • Kendo UI 和 Angular - $scope 中没有小部件

    我使用 Kendo UI 版本 2014 2 716 和 AngularJS 版本 1 2 27 并使用指令创建了一个网格 div div div div
  • 加载 angularjs 路由后运行 javascript 代码

    我需要在 angularjs 加载路线后显示警报 显示警报的代码位于 angularjs 异步加载的视图中 视图加载后 我希望它能够运行 但它没有 我知道我可以广播并告诉它稍后运行等 但我需要一个更通用的解决方案 假设您正在谈论基于以下内容
  • 如何在 {{}} AngularJS 中使用 JavaScript

    我知道 可以解释表达式 但是当我尝试在其中使用 javascript 时 它的工作方式并不像 a b c d split filter function n return n reverse 0 我需要使用它从 url 获取 slug 值
  • CORS 问题。 Flask <-> AngularJS

    使用 angularjs 客户端应用程序和提供 api 的 Flask 应用程序启动一个新项目 我使用 mongodb 作为数据库 我必须立即排除 jsonp 因为我需要能够跨不同端口进行 POST 因此 我们为 Angular 应用程序设
  • 如果没有其他函数链接到承诺,则默认行为

    我想打开一个 确认您要取消对话框 如果没有链接其他功能 则默认导航回页面 window history back 如果我传递回调 我可能会这样做 function openCancelModal form callback if form
  • 从 AngularJS 控制器调用 jQuery 函数

    我有一个下面的按钮 单击时会显示一个类似通知的小弹出窗口
  • 使用 Protractor 检查浏览器控制台中没有错误

    我正在使用 Protractor 来测试 AngularJS 我想检查在测试结束时是否没有发生未捕获的异常并打印到浏览器控制台 有没有一种简单的方法可以做到这一点 如果您将 Protractor 与 Jasmine 一起使用 请使用以下代码
  • Yeoman-Angular 生成的应用程序中缺少 Angular 脚本

    我已经使用 Yeoman Angular Generator 生成了一个应用程序 但项目中缺少 angular js 和其他 Angular 文件 我可以在 Bower json 文件中看到这些依赖项 如下所示 name mi portfo
  • Outlook Rest 调用表单 angularjs

    使用 Outlook 我正在尝试创建事件 当我使用 POSTMAN 发送请求时 它工作正常 但 Angularjs 中的相同代码却不起作用 代码有什么问题 请帮忙 scope createEvents function var url ht
  • 将 memoize 函数与 underscore.js 一起使用

    我正在尝试使用 ajax 调用缓存结果memoize函数来自Underscore js 我不确定我的实施情况 以及如何使用密钥检索缓存的结果数据 下面是我的实现 JavaScript 代码 var cdata http get HOST U
  • 以编程方式更改模型时,AngularJS 自定义验证不会触发

    我创建了一个自定义验证器 要求日期必须是过去的日期 当手动在字段中输入日期时 验证似乎效果很好 但是 如果我以编程方式输入更改日期 直接更改模型而不是在字段中键入 则验证不会触发 我相信我正在按照文档中的指示执行自定义验证指令 这是一个js
  • 粘性页脚不粘在 AngularJS 中

    Im working an angular site and im trying to implement a sticky footer across all views but the footer stops sticking whe
  • Cordova 文件传输到节点服务器

    我正在使用 ng Cordova fileTransfer 插件尝试将用户相机胶卷中的照片上传到 Node Express 服务器 我正在获取照片的本地 URI 并尝试将其传递给插件 如下所示 cordovaFileTransfer upl
  • 如何使用 Vert.x 2.x 启用 CORS

    我正在尝试使用 Angularjs 1 4 5 发出跨域请求 但无法获得成功 我已经配置了 httpprovider config httpProvider function httpProvider httpProvider defaul
  • 如何更改 AngularJS HTTP 调用的基本 URL?

    我的应用程序多次调用 HTTP 如下所示 this http method this method url this url this url 始终设置为 app getdata 之类的内容 现在我已将应用程序的后端移至另一台服务器 我将需
  • 角度斜线被编码

    我和这个人有同样的问题 angularjs slash after hashbang gets encoded https stackoverflow com questions 17530924 angularjs slash after
  • Angularjs + Typescript,如何将 $routeParams 与 IRouteParamsService 一起使用

    我使用 routeParams 从 URI 中提取属性并为其设置本地变量 当我使用打字稿输入设置 route 参数的类型时 我无法再访问 route 参数 如何访问 routeParams 中的属性 class Controller con
  • AngularJS 中的全局模拟对象用于 jasmine/karma 测试

    我有一个正在模拟进行单元测试的对象 基本上在我的测试文件中 我将其模拟如下 var mockObject mockMethod1 function return true mockMethod2 function return true b
  • 为什么 AngularJS 在使用 ng-bind-html 时会去掉 data- 属性?

    我正在使用 contentEditable div 来使用户能够格式化他们的文章 我对html内容做了一些处理并保留它 我在用ng bind html当观众想要阅读文章时呈现结果 我不想使用 sce trustAsHtml因为我仍然希望 A

随机推荐

  • boost电路公式详解

    这个是我在设计boost电路遇到问题时找的文章 觉得说的很好 所以就转载过来方便查看 原文链接 https www eet china com mp a68179 html 以下是那边文章的内容 我们知道 不论是buck 还是boost电路
  • Centos7搭建简单的Samba服务器

    目录 背景要求 环境准备 在centos7中搭建一个简单的samba服务器用于测试 帮助理解samba服务的简易用法 背景要求 设置公共目录 所有人可以访问 权限为只 读 为结算中心和技术部分别建立单独的目录 只 允许公司总经理和对应部门员
  • 高德地图自定义车辆定位marker以及弹出框窗口

    地图安装 npm install vue amap save 项目中设置高德地图 安装成功后在main js设置以下内容 import VueAMap from vue amap Vue use VueAMap VueAMap initAM
  • 邻接矩阵无向图

    邻接矩阵 无向图和有向图在邻接矩阵中的表示方法 无向图和有向图大同小异 在这里只以无向图为例 代码部分通过简单调整即可对应编译有向图 邻接矩阵数据类型定义 define MaxVertices 100 定义最大容量 typedef stru
  • ASP.NET系统用户权限设计与实现

    引言 电子商务系统对安全问题有较高的要求 传统的访问控制方法DAC Discretionary Access Control 自主访问控制模型 MAC Mandatory Access Control 强制访问控制模型 难以满足复杂的企业环
  • react-native及npm install 安装问题

    我们项目中已经开始用react native 所以swift学习放下一段时间 学了一个月的rn 今天分享记录学习过程 学习资料整理 1 react native 中文网 http reactnative cn docs 0 27 getti
  • Qt-认清信号槽的本质

    目录 放个目录方便预览 这个目录是从博客复制过来的 点击会跳转到博客 简介 猫和老鼠的故事 对象之间的通信机制 尝试一 直接调用 尝试二 回调函数 映射表 观察者模式 Qt的信号 槽 信号 槽简介 信号 槽分两种 信号 槽的实现 元对象编译
  • 数据研发面经——字节跳动

    数据研发面经 字节跳动 1 抽象类与接口 2 多态 3 四种引用 4 锁 并发怎么处理 5 进程和线程的区别 6 shuffle机制 mapreduce流程 7 JVM虚拟机 为什么需要虚拟机 8 内存区域 五部分 栈和堆区别 具体存放的东
  • 2017.10.9 DZY Loves Math VI 失败总结

    一看到love math就知道肯定不会做 首先lcm拆成i j gcd i j 然后就讨论分子和分母 但并没有什么卵用 这个题对比传统反演题 主要不同的是f函数不是很直观 所以如果枚举gcd 那剩下的两个数一定互质 然后就按照gcd 1的反
  • 思科VoIP配置清单(转)

    我配过简单的VoIP 用的是思科的设备 希望对你有用 R1接口为192 168 1 1 R2接口为192 168 1 2 R1 R2直连 并相互各连两部电话 要想实现互相通话 可以做如下配置 其中 5164765 6239560为连接R1的
  • C# 创建Excel并写入内容

    在许多应用程序中 需要将数据导出为Excel表格 以便用户可以轻松地查看和分析数据 在本文中 我们将讨论如何使用C 创建Excel表格 并将数据写入该表格 添加引用 在C 中创建Excel表格 需要使用Microsoft Office In
  • Typora和PicGo-Core搭配使用(解决博客单独上传图片问题)

    前言 本文简单介绍快速上传图片并获取图片 URL 链接的工具 图片存放到Gitee仓库中 在博客网站发布时不必担心图片转存失败问题 解决本地图片在网站需单独上传的难题 将本地图片存储在网络中 图床 并生成URL 联网情况下通过URL链接即可
  • Unity之六:项目实战篇

    文章目录 一 一个简单的实例 二 使用CMake组织项目与Unity 2 1 目录结构 2 2 CMakeLists txt的编写 2 3 使用实例 一 一个简单的实例 一个测试单元是源文件 测试文件和Unity构成的 把他们放在一起进行编
  • 【算法提升】——异或理解,位的运算

    个人主页 努力学习的少年 版权 本文由 努力学习的少年 原创 在CSDN首发 需要转载请联系博主 如果文章对你有帮助 欢迎关注 点赞 收藏 一键三连 和订阅专栏哦 目录 一 只出现一次的数字 1 二 数组中只出现一次的数字2 一 只出现一次
  • localStorage在Safari浏览器无痕模式下失效

    Safari无痕模式是不能使用localStorage的 可以利用这个特性判断用户是否开启无痕模式 并提醒用户关闭无痕模式 if typeof localStorage object try localStorage setItem loc
  • 学习笔记 JavaScript ES6 异步编程Promise

    Promise ES里面对异步操作的第一种方案 学习Promise 让异常操作变得优雅 Promise的精髓在于异步操作的状态管理 一个Promise最基本用法 他的参数是一个方法 这个方法里有两个参数 一个是异步操作执行成功的回调 一个是
  • DC综合脚本中文详细解释

    script for Design Compiler DC综合编译脚本 language TCL 语言说明 Usage 使用说明 1 make sure the lib in the current directory 确保设计库在正确的文
  • Xcode项目设置项中的LLVM

    LLVM是构架编译器
  • html5开发手机打电话发短信功能,html5的高级开发,html5开发大全,html手机电话短信功能详解

    原文地址 http blog csdn net xmtblog article details 32931905 在很多的手机网站上 有打电话和发短信的功能 对于这些功能是如何实现的呢 其实不难 今天我们就用html5来实现他们 简单的让你
  • Angular--官方文档之 Angular CLI

    学习Angular官方文档的时候 参考https angular cn guide quickstart 这个快速开发的文档 对于我这个AngularJs小白在看了Angular菜鸟教程后 只能说可以简单的运用一下 看到一些专业术语 我也是